Every group consists of main muscles, which are bolstered by secondary muscles that assist in various movements.
The triceps brachii primarily functions to extend the forearm and also plays a supportive role in pulling the arm towards the body, enhancing the action of the latissimus dorsi. The function of the biceps brachii muscle includes enabling the elbow to bend, pulling the arm closer to the body, and twisting the forearm so that the palm is facing upwards.

Developing robust arm strength is essential, focusing especially on increasing the upper arm muscles' force. Strengthen the upper arm, brachialis, and brachioradialis by engaging in activities like hammer curls and barbell curls. Incline dumbbell curls are particularly effective for engaging the long head of the biceps brachii muscle, ensuring thorough activation, while curls executed with a low pulley system are beneficial for stimulating the entire biceps, enhancing blood circulation and muscle contraction. Maintaining a slight bend in the elbows during heavy lifting can protect the biceps tendon from harm.
Ensure that your workout routine targets both the muscles at the back of your upper arms and those at the front to maintain even muscle growth in that area. Understanding the unique attributes of your physique is crucial for improving sports performance and avoiding harm. Individual differences in the effects of exercise are significantly influenced by anatomical features, including the extent of movement and the specific locations where muscles connect to the body. Differences in body structure can influence numerous aspects, including the alignment of the upper body while performing squats and the probability of sustaining tendon damage from continuous stress.
